Buying Guide

The best sandwich cookies are not one-size-fits-all. Shoppers face a wide spectrum of flavors, filling ratios, package sizes, and ingredient standards. Understanding how these variables affect taste and practicality will help you choose a box that actually disappears from the pantry instead of going stale.

At its core, a sandwich cookie is two crisp wafers joined by a layer of creme. The most common archetype is the chocolate wafer with vanilla filling, but the category now includes golden vanilla, peanut butter, lemon, and even spiced speculoos bases. Chocolate-dominant cookies tend to be crowd-pleasers because the slight bitterness of the cocoa balances the sugary filling. Golden or vanilla wafers offer a milder, butterier base that lets the creme flavor shine through, which is why lemon or specialty cremes are often paired with lighter wafers.

If you are buying for a mixed group, classic chocolate sandwich cookies are the safest bet. If you are shopping for a household that already eats the classics regularly, rotating in a lemon or peanut butter variation can keep snack time from feeling repetitive. European-style options bring warm cinnamon or brown-sugar notes that pair especially well with coffee, making them a strong choice for adult palates.

Package Sizes and Household Fit

Sandwich cookies come in formats ranging from single-serve packs to large resealable tubs. The right size depends on how quickly your household will finish them. A standard box is usually sufficient for one or two people who want an occasional dessert. Larger party sizes make sense for families with children, office break rooms, or anyone who packs lunches daily. The key is to match consumption speed to package volume so the last few cookies do not go soft.

Resealable packaging is a subtle but important feature. Once a bag is opened, exposure to air degrades the snap of the wafer and can crystallize the creme. Party-size bags with sturdy zip-style closures tend to preserve texture longer than simple fold-over sleeves. If you prefer to buy in bulk but worry about freshness, consider whether the product is available in individually wrapped portions, which trade a small amount of packaging waste for maximum crunch over time.

Texture and Filling Tradeoffs

Not all sandwich cookies share the same mouthfeel. Some wafers are thin and crisp, designed to shatter cleanly when you bite. Others are slightly thicker and more durable, which helps them survive shipping and dunking in milk. The filling matters just as much. Standard creme layers provide a balanced wafer-to-filling ratio, while double-stuffed versions flip that ratio to emphasize sweetness and creaminess. If you enjoy dipping cookies, a thicker wafer usually holds up better. If you snack dry, a thinner wafer with moderate filling may feel less heavy.

Flavor mashups, such as peanut butter creme inside a chocolate wafer, introduce denser fillings that can feel richer. These are excellent for satisfying a sweet tooth quickly, but they can also feel indulgent in a way that limits how many you want to eat in one sitting. Think about whether you want a light, repeatable snack or a treat that feels like a small dessert.

Dietary and Ingredient Considerations

Mainstream sandwich cookies are generally vegetarian, but ingredients can vary. Some brands rely on hydrogenated oils and artificial flavors, while others use simpler recipes with non-GMO or plant-based ingredients. If you are shopping for a household with dietary restrictions, check whether the creme contains dairy or if the wafers use wheat flour. A few options on the market emphasize cleaner labels, omitting high-fructose corn syrup and synthetic additives. These tend to taste slightly less sweet than conventional versions, which some adults prefer but children may notice.

Allergen cross-contamination is another factor. Peanut butter-filled varieties are obviously unsuitable for nut-free environments, and facilities that process multiple allergens may pose risks for sensitive individuals. When in doubt, simpler flavors from brands with transparent sourcing often provide the most predictable ingredient lists.

How to Evaluate Reviews and Reliability

When comparing sandwich cookies online, look beyond the star average and read what recent reviewers say about freshness and breakage. A high rating with thousands of reviews usually indicates consistent manufacturing and reliable shipping. However, if you see clusters of complaints about stale product or crumbled wafers, that may signal supply-chain issues or inadequate packaging rather than a bad recipe.

Pay attention to review velocity. A product with a strong average but only a handful of recent reviews may have changed recipes or suppliers. Conversely, an item with thousands of purchases in the past month and a steady stream of new feedback is more likely to reflect the current batch quality. Photos in reviews can also reveal whether the actual filling amount matches the marketing or if the wafers arrive intact.
